Tips wise, I have the spiral dot which I have great fit, the large white tips from re-400 which I also like, spin fit but the large doesn't look it's giving me good fit/isolation plus the tenore's and puro's tips. Currently I am using India's largest tip but feel the fit is not perfect. The spiral dot with great fit made the sound a little bit boomier but I may try it again. I have large ear canal and can't find a recommendation for x large tips with good reviews.
As for powering the puro, I am using Samsung galaxy edge+ and for some songs it needs more power and therefore I ordered Teac's ha-p50-b and will decide accordingly.
I believe what you say about puro's capability but I am not hearing what you are describing for several reasons, tips, not enough power, also my hearing is not perfect, have little bit difficulty in hearing, and that could be the main reason.

Another one to consider besides the Tenores is the First Harmonic ieb6, it has a mic and button that works with Android. Press once for play/pause and double click to skip to next track. It's a little brighter than the Tenores and a little more low end but still very very good and only $40 on Amazon with Prime too. I gave them to my gf bc of the brightness issue but listening to them again right now and either they have tamed themselves with her mild listening or my E07K now on 6db gain they are much better. They even more tiny than the Tenores.
